Your unique talents will help patients on their journey to wellness. Learn more at are searching for the best talent for theSenior Director Medical Affairsto be based in Irvine CA.
The Senior Director Medical Affairs develops and drives the top-level decision-making of the development and implementation of the respective global medical affairs strategic and tactical plans.
Responsible for the MSL organization and Field Research Specialists. Drives KOL/PI/site level engagement plans.
Leads the development and execution of advisory boards scientific and medical education programs. Provides scientific/medical education to all relevant internal stakeholders related to therapeutic area or disease specific information.
Formulates evidence plans and organization activities based on project life cycles and stakeholder and client feedback.
Supports strategic development and execution of publication plans and scientific communications for all clinical programs.
Responsible for Medical Information Request process copy approval and provides support and development on field-based educational and promotional materials for scientific accuracy.
Provides medical affairs expertise and support to product development teams and medical affairs teams including training to other staff internally across functions.
Partners with commercial and clinical development to support product strategy based on external and internal input.
Establishes academic cooperation and maintains communication channels with medical experts in relevant disease areas.
Responsible for managing operational aspects of their teams (e.g. budget performance and compliance) as well as implementing workforce and succession plans to meet business needs.
